1. Submit Inquiry & Complete Application
Start by submitting your inquiry and filling out our franchise application form. This allows our team to learn more about your background, goals, and interest in joining our insurance franchise network.
2. Consultation
Once we receive your application, our team will schedule a consultation to discuss the opportunity in more detail. During this conversation, we’ll answer your questions, explain our business model, and determine if the franchise is the right fit for both sides.
3. Review Franchise Disclosure Document
You will receive the FDD, which outlines important details about the franchise system, including fees, responsibilities, and operational guidelines. This step gives you the opportunity to carefully review the agreement and fully understand.
4. Sign the Franchise Agreement
After reviewing the FDD and deciding to move forward, you will sign the franchise agreement. This officially secures your position as a franchise owner and allows us to begin preparing for the launch of your agency.
5. Training & Agency Setup
Once approved, you will participate in our comprehensive training program. We provide guidance on insurance products, sales strategies, systems, and operational processes while assisting you with setting up your agency.
6. Grand Opening
After completing training and final preparations, your agency will officially open. Our team will continue supporting you with marketing resources, operational guidance, and ongoing mentorship to help your business grow, ensuring you have the support needed for success.

Franchise FAQ
What does the Pini Insurance franchise include?
It includes access to the brand, training, operating processes, sales tools, ongoing support, and a clear roadmap for opening, sales, and growth. During the evaluation call, we’ll share the exact package based on your city and profile.
How much does it cost to open a franchise?
Investment varies depending on the model (new office, conversion, multi-unit), location, and setup needs. To give you a realistic range, we first confirm your target area and goals, then share the full details during the presentation.
Do I need prior insurance experience?
Not necessarily. We look for candidates with sales ability and leadership. If you have experience in sales/services (for example: taxes, real estate, auto sales, or similar), that’s often an advantage. The training is designed to accelerate your learning curve.
Do I need a license to sell insurance?
In most cases, yes—and the exact requirement depends on the state. We’ll guide you through the right path (and possible structures with licensed agents) during the evaluation process.
How long does it take from applying to opening?
It depends on your situation (licensing, location, hiring, and setup). Typically, the process moves in stages: application → call → approval → training → preparation → opening. On your call, we’ll provide a timeline estimate based on your case.
